Camp Dennison is a small unincorporated Hamilton County community in the Little Miami River valley along US-22 and OH-126, northeast of Cincinnati between Newtown and Loveland. The Little Miami State Scenic River corridor through Camp Dennison shares the valley with US-22, which serves as a primary freight arterial connecting the northeastern Hamilton County industrial zone to the Warren County and Clermont County networks to the east and northeast. Contractor trucks, building materials haulers, and regional distribution vehicles use US-22 through the Camp Dennison valley as an alternative to I-275 when the beltway is congested, and the valley road geometry through this section creates the same limited-shoulder breakdown challenges found throughout the Little Miami corridor.

Camp Dennison and the US-22 Little Miami River valley corridor carry freight moving between northeastern Hamilton County and the Warren and Clermont county networks to the east. Building materials and construction contractor freight are the primary commercial vehicle categories — the active residential and commercial development market in the Newtown, Anderson, and Clermont County growth zone generates consistent contractor truck traffic on US-22 through the valley. Regional LTL and retail distribution trucks use US-22 as an I-275 bypass when beltway traffic builds during the Cincinnati commuter peak. OH-126 through Camp Dennison also connects to Milford and the I-275 interchange, providing an alternate beltway access route for valley-road freight.
